I LOVE Omnifocus! I am starting a new partnership and have got my partner hooked on it as well. However, we would like to be able to keep our project tasks in sync as well as assign them to each other. So really I see two challenges here:

1. Is it possible to do some sort of assignment? I have been trying to think of a way to use contexts to accomplish this. However, the only way I could think of is to have person specific contexts. That seems that it would get out of control fast. Has anyone else come up with a nice way of doing this?

2. How can I sync tasks with my partner? I was thinking with the WebDav syncing coming with the new iPhone release. Could I sync to multiple WebDav servers? Could I sync to MobileMe (for my iPhone) as well as an additional server for my partner and me. Also, I don't want to sync all tasks. Will there be a way to only sync certain tasks?

I appreciate any help that you may be able to provide!
